RealRides of WNY #2485 (on the road) - 1972 BMW 2002

SEATTLE, Washington – When this 1972 BMW 2002 was new it was aimed at a whole different clientele than many of today’s sport sedans. Mostly driven by true driving enthusiasts, the 2002 pretty much cemented BMW’s place as the (self-proclaimed) Ultimate Driving Machine. It also takes us back to a time when they still referred to themselves in ads as the Bavarian Motor Works (Bayerische Motoren Werke in the home market, where the car's name is pronounced Bee Em Vee). BMW had a catchy German phrase used in some of their ads back in the day, and no, it wasn’t Fahrvergnügen (that was  Volkswagen), but rather Freude am Fahrensheer driving pleasure. If the current crop of BMWs has a catchy slogan, it’s been lost on me. Today’s RealRide was photographed back in 2018 by my daughter Katie.
